2017年8月19日
摘要: T1珠心算——暴力模拟 #include<iostream> #include<cstdio> #include<algorithm> #include<cstring> using namespace std; inline int read(){ int t=1,num=0;char c=get 阅读全文
posted @ 2017-08-19 21:41 Yzyet 阅读(263) 评论(0) 推荐(0) 编辑
摘要: 我随机跳题,跳到了这题,乍一看,不就博弈论吗,题目明明白白的告诉了我们。 诶.........丧啊。。。不会。。。。。。。 万般无奈,看了一下题解,是一个叫做威佐夫博弈的东西。 然后百度一下,盯着半天,终于会了,你们也可以百度哦。百度写得足够详细了。 本文由Yzyet编写,网址为www.cnblog 阅读全文
posted @ 2017-08-19 21:34 Yzyet 阅读(231) 评论(0) 推荐(0) 编辑
摘要: 为了做noip2013的火柴排序,特地练了一下逆序对的求法。 逆序对的求法,若要nlogn,有2种,一种就是用归并排序的思想。另一种,就是线段树或者树状数组。 这里,我采用了第一种。 #include<iostream> #include<cstdio> #include<algorithm> #i 阅读全文
posted @ 2017-08-19 21:28 Yzyet 阅读(164) 评论(0) 推荐(0) 编辑
摘要: 作为D1T2的这题,做法的确挺巧妙的。 首先,我们发现: 对于a1<a2, b1>b2 则 (a1-b1)^2+(a2-b2)^2>(a1-b2)^2+(a2-b1)^2 自己拆开推一下就知道了。。 然后我们对数据进行离散化。把b数组的元素映射到a里。 由于我们需要求,使映射完的结果不下降,需要调换 阅读全文
posted @ 2017-08-19 21:25 Yzyet 阅读(159) 评论(0) 推荐(0) 编辑